SpletA pronouncing and defining dictionary of the Swatow dialect, arranged according to syllables and tones (IA pronouncingdefin00fielrich).pdf This file is in DjVu, a computer file format designed primarily to store scanned documents. … The Swatow dialect, or in Mandarin the Shantou dialect, is a Chinese dialect mostly spoken in Shantou in Guangdong, China. It is a dialect of Chaoshan Min language. It is also mutually intelligible to Teochew to a large extent. Prikaži več • Fielde, Adele M. (1883). A pronouncing and defining dictionary of the Swatow dialect, arranged according to syllables and tones. Shanghai: American Presbyterian Mission Press. Retrieved 2015-04-01.
